@uploadcare/file-uploader
Version:
Building blocks for Uploadcare products integration
20 lines (15 loc) • 381 B
JavaScript
export const CameraSourceTypes = Object.freeze({
PHOTO: 'photo',
VIDEO: 'video',
});
export const CameraSourceEvents = Object.freeze({
IDLE: 'idle',
SHOT: 'shot',
PLAY: 'play',
PAUSE: 'pause',
RESUME: 'resume',
STOP: 'stop',
RETAKE: 'retake',
ACCEPT: 'accept',
});
/** @typedef {(typeof CameraSourceTypes)[keyof typeof CameraSourceTypes]} ModeCameraType */